Maker:
Onkyo Corporation, Japan – a respected name in high-fidelity audio, known for crafting reliable and well-designed stereo equipment since the 1940s. These particular models were part of Onkyo’s mid-range to high-end lineup in the mid-to-late 1970s.

Condition:
Excellent overall (visually). All knobs and switches are present, meters are intact, and labeling is crisp. However, functional testing is recommended to verify audio performance, especially with vintage capacitors and belts (especially in the cassette deck).
